Learning the Facts About Fixed Interest Securities

In this article, we look at how fixed-interest securities work and the roles that they play for both individual investors and the economy. This is useful reading if you’re studying for the CII’s R02, J10 or AF4 exams.

What are fixed-interest securities?

A fixed-interest security is a type of bond that generates a fixed income over a given period.

In simple terms, the bond is an I.O.U. from the borrowing institution, e.g. a government, local authority, or company, to the lender (the investor), that guarantees a fixed return over an agreed term and repayment of the original loan.

For both individual and institutional investors, fixed-interest securities can be packaged as different products, like government or corporate bond funds as part of a unit trust or OEIC offering. They may also be wrapped in ISAs or pensions for tax efficiency. Individual government and corporate bonds are traded on the stock market, so once issued their values can rise and fall.

Different Types of Fixed-Interest Securities

Two of the most common forms of fixed-interest securities in the UK are government ‘gilts’ and corporate bonds.

Transfers into Discretionary Trusts

In this Brand Bitesize video, we take a look at how transfers into discretionary trusts work in practice when either the trustees or the settlor pays the tax due. This could be useful for anyone studying for the CII’s R03, J02, or AF1 exams. It could potentially appear on the R06 and AF5 exams as well.

Transfers into discretionary trusts are called Chargeable Lifetime Transfers (CLTs). An immediate charge to IHT is triggered if the value of the CLT is over the settlor’s available nil rate band. You can find out more, including a worked example, in the Brand Bitesize video below.

Updates to CII Study Texts

Here’s a reminder that the CII update their study texts throughout the examinable year to either incorporate new legislations, correct errors or clarify information. Many candidates aren’t aware of this, which can result in candidates studying out-of-date information.

To find out if you have the most up-to-date information, visit the CII website, navigate to your chosen exam and click on ‘learning solutions update’ in the ‘Unit updates’ section in the sidebar.
